4. MAINTENANCE

4.26 ECCENTRICS

Test vibration with front drum on soft ground. Run

engine at full rpm to obtain vib spec 2100 + 100 rpm –

check per below.

To check vibration with a vibrotach, place the

vibrotach on the vibrating member surface, record

reading when the wire reaches maximum movement.

(Vibrotach P/N 37891).

When checking vibration with strobe light, place

horizontal line on vibrating member surface. Check

with strobe light and record reading when the line

reaches minimum movement.

4.26.1 Eccentric Housing Oil

ROLLER MUST BE PARKED ON LEVEL

GROUND WITH PARKING BRAKE APPLIED AND

ENGINE OFF.

REMOVE THE KEY AND / OR DISCONNECT

BATTERY TO AVOID ACCIDENTAL IGNITION

OF ENGINE. SEVERE PERSONAL INJURY MAY

OCCUR.

NEVER WORK ON THE ROLLER WITH ENGINE

RUNNING. SEVERE PERSONAL INJURY MAY

OCCUR.

Eccentric housing oil should be checked monthly and

changed every 800 hours or yearly. Refer to

Maintenance Chart.

To check, locate oil plug inside the right hand drum

end and position drum so that oil plug is visible at 7:00.

Loosen oil plug slowly until oil starts to drip out past

the oil plug. Oil must be present at the 7:00 position.

Add oil if required and reinstall oil plug, use thread

sealant.

Eccentric housing oil:

SAE 20W/50 API SJ or API SH

SD/PD 43 1 qt. (.95 L.)

SP/PD 54 1.5 qt. (1.4 L.)

4.27 CHARGE SYSTEM

If gauge fails to function, check charge system. With

the engine running at full speed, voltage should be 13-

14 volts across the battery (check volt meter). If unit is

charging, replace gauge. If not, see authorized engine

dealer to check alternator.

4.28 PANEL FUSE 20 AMP

This fuse provides protection for the electrical system.

If the engine fails to turnover when starting, check the

fuse.

NEVER USE FUSE WITH A DIFFERENT RATING

FROM THAT SPECIFIED. SERIOUS DAMAGE

TO THE ELECTRICAL SYSTEM OR A FIRE MAY

RESULT.

TURN THE ENGINE SWITCH OFF AND REMOVE

THE KEY BEFORE CHECKING OR REPLACING

FUSES TO PREVENT ACCIDENTAL SHORT-

CIRCUITING.

When frequent fuse failure occurs, it usually indicates

a short circuit or an overload in the electrical system.

See your authorized engine dealer for repair.

4.29 ENGINE INSTALLATION GUIDELINES

When installing new or reworking used diesel engines,

this list of guidelines should be strictly adhered to.

Following these guidelines should prevent damage to

the electrical system of diesel engines.

A. Always disconnect the positive cable from the

battery before performing any work on the

machine that involves welding or working on

the electrical system.

B. Avoid jump starting a diesel engine. Either change

the battery or remove the positive cable and charge

the battery.

C. Do not alter or change the wiring harness.
